@@ -22,12 +22,16 @@ class Clock;
namespace offline_pages {
-// Limit of the total storage space occupied by offline pages should be 30% of
-// available storage. And we clear storage when it is over the threshold,
-// reducing the usage below threshold.
+// Maximum % of total available storage that will be occupied by offline pages
+// before a storage clearup.
const double kOfflinePageStorageLimit = 0.3;
+// The target % of storage usage we try to reach below when expiring pages.
const double kOfflinePageStorageClearThreshold = 0.1;
+// The time that the storage cleanup will be triggered again since the last one.
const base::TimeDelta kClearStorageInterval = base::TimeDelta::FromMinutes(10);
+// The time that the page record will be removed from the store since the page
+// has been expired.
+const base::TimeDelta kRemovePageItemInterval = base::TimeDelta::FromDays(21);
